| − | Solar energy can be used to distill water, a process which usually can render drinkable water out of salt water. There is a process whereby water put in plastic polyethylene terepthalate bottles is cleansed so it can be drunk, known as SODIS, which stands for solar water disinfection. The process is dependent upon the weather, and can require a fair period of time. With gloomy conditions it is two days, but with good weather it lessens to a low of six hours. In developing nations, there are currently two million people acquiring their daily drinking water implementing SODIS.

| − | One of the means whereby electricity is created from sunlight is referred to as photovoltaic, or PV for short. It has been implemented a lot for powering items that are minimal to medium in size. For example, think of calculators, in which one solar cell provides the electrical power. Photovoltaic is even used to power some homes. Solar energy's most typical uses, though, are the heating of water and the interior of houses. Also increasing in popularity is ventilation and photo voltaic air heating. Of the three prevalent ways of capturing solar energy, solar cells is definitely the most popular. Called photovoltaic or photoelectric cells, they transform light directly into electricity.
